Model showing the role of AKAP-Lbc in the regulation of Shp2 activity by PKA. AKAP-Lbc assembles a signaling complex composed of PKA and Shp2 in cardiac myocytes. Stress conditions (e.g. chronic activation of the β-adrenergic receptor) lead to PKA activation, thereby promoting inhibition of Shp2 activity, which may contribute to the induction of cardiac hypertrophy.
